66% Humidity. Hot and humid.
Fast course that is mostly wide and straight across top of dam with ~40ft (12m) downhill in the last 200 meters (elevation according to gps, I don't think it's that steep, I'd say closer to 20-30ft drop maybe?).
Problem was mostly strong headwind and crosswind all the way, no tailwind at all (weather station recorded wind speed of 18.4mph and gust of 27.6mph)
Garmin: 5:45.49 (3:35/km)
Official: 5:45.90 (3:35/km)
GPS was spot on likely because of clear sky and straight course.
There were 4 heats, <6min, 6-8min, 8-10min, and the rest. Coach told me to join heat 1, I started in the back of the group expecting to be almost last knowing that my 1500m time trial would put me barely at 5:59 (5k PR projected 6:04)
1st quarter: Trying to keep pace with the group which went out really fast. Pace dropped quite a bit afterward. Breathing started to suck soon and commanded my attention all the way through the race.
2nd quarter: Trying to stay steady with the few runners in a group, breathing sucked
3rd quarter: Arms and shoulders losing strength and had trouble keeping up with the pumping, I had probably never ran this hard before and the lack of upper body strength was apparent (result of no cross training).
4th quarter: Last 400m felt like a very very slight gentle decline and a few runners near me were speeding up, I followed. I think I may have kicked too early. Last 200m the downhill started, landing was hard and I was afraid of falling over. Breathing at its worst. I actually had slowed (according to garmin) probably due to the pounding on the legs, or suffering oxygen debt from the early kick, although it felt like I was flying (or falling).
Quarter splits based on gps:
Dist Time Delta Pace/mi Pace/km
0.25 1:19.5 1:19.5 5:18/mi 3:18/km
0.50 2:47.5 1:28.0 5:52/mi 3:39/km
0.75 4:17.5 1:30.0 6:00/mi 3:44/km
1.00 5:45.9 1:28.4 5:54/mi 3:40/km
